For example, part of the American Adventure pavilion is closing soon! Let’s talk about it.
The George W. Bush Institute is loaning 60 portraits of service members and veterans painted by former President George W. Bush to the American Adventure Pavilion in EPCOT. As one gallery enters, that means another must leave Disney World.

The American Heritage Gallery currently inside the American Adventure Pavilion will close for refurbishment starting tomorrow, May 28th, 2024.

The portraits will debut in this space on June 9th, 2024, and are part of an exhibit called Portraits of Courage: A Commander in Chief’s Tribute to America’s Warriors. The former President wrote a biography to accompany each portrait. Information about resources to support veterans and their families will also be available inside the exhibit.

The goal of the exhibit is to “remember the leadership, service, and sacrifice behind each of the heroes painted and the unique challenges our service members and their families face when transitioning out of the military.” This is according to Ken Hersh, president and CEO of the George W. Bush Presidential Center.

That’s not the only closure happening in EPCOT! The Disney Vacation Club member lounge located in the Imagination Pavilion is also set to close soon. It will shut its doors for refurbishment for over a month starting on June 2nd. In the meantime, members can visit the Odyssey pavilion which will act as a temporary lounge location.

On the other hand, we’ll be celebrating a huge opening in Disney World soon. It’s finally time for CommuniCore Hall and Plaza to emerge from behind the construction walls and open to visitors!

This space will have it all — festival areas, a stage for performances, a Mickey and Friends meet and greet area, and a new Encanto show. The area and final mark of the EPCOT transformation opens on June 10th, 2024.
